Interface for Adaptive Manifold Filter realizations.

For more details about this filter see CITE: Gastal12 and References_.

Below listed optional parameters which may be set up with Algorithm::set function.

  • member double sigma_s = 16.0 Spatial standard deviation.
  • member double sigma_r = 0.2 Color space standard deviation.
  • member int tree_height = -1 Height of the manifold tree (default = -1 : automatically computed).
  • member int num_pca_iterations = 1 Number of iterations to computed the eigenvector.
  • member bool adjust_outliers = false Specify adjust outliers using Eq. 9 or not.
  • member bool use_RNG = true Specify use random number generator to compute eigenvector or not.

  • Apply high-dimensional filtering using adaptive manifolds.

    Declaration

    Objective-C

    - (void)filter:(nonnull Mat *)src
               dst:(nonnull Mat *)dst
             joint:(nonnull Mat *)joint;

    Swift

    func filter(src: Mat, dst: Mat, joint: Mat)

    Parameters

    src

    filtering image with any numbers of channels.

    dst

    output image.

    joint

    optional joint (also called as guided) image with any numbers of channels.
